Too Many Creeps on Sunday nights, Pussy Galore on Fridays. I highly recommend the first two (even though I haven't been to TMC, it's run by one of the guys in Blessure Grave) but why settle for a club night when you can do the following:

Hit The San Diego Natural History Museum for Body Works and Museum of Man
Snoop around Mount Hope/Holy Cross Cemetery
Take a walk around Ocean Beach
Check out Downtown/Gaslamp
Go to Lou's/Off The Record/Record City/Taaang! for record shopping
